White Door Games — Game Developer

Name Release Date Current Players All-Time Peak Rating
Cosmodread Cosmodread 25 Mar, 2021 2 4 84.79
Dreadhalls Dreadhalls 9 Mar, 2017 1 2 86.14
File uploading